What this form is about
Form 004-0455 is the Application by an Insurance Company for Auto Insurance Dispute Resolution under the Insurance Act, used when an insurer seeks a LAT-AABS ruling on a statutory accident benefits dispute — confirm filing rules at tribunalsontario.ca.
Before you start: what to gather
- Insurer legal name and company address.
- Authorized representative name, title, phone, and email.
- Claimant name and policy or claim number.
- Disputed benefit and decision being appealed.
